誰該為軟件質(zhì)量負(fù)責(zé)------質(zhì)量偽神 vs 真人類?
作者:網(wǎng)絡(luò)轉(zhuǎn)載 發(fā)布時(shí)間:[ 2011/10/14 13:38:23 ] 推薦標(biāo)簽:
我接觸過數(shù)以千計(jì)的測(cè)試員,他們都有這么一個(gè)觀點(diǎn):我從事的是測(cè)試工作,我是對(duì)質(zhì)量負(fù)責(zé)的人。甚至有些人認(rèn)為自己是產(chǎn)品質(zhì)量的守護(hù)神。
我想問的問題是:這種想法對(duì)我們有好處嗎?
下面是我的一些看法,同時(shí)也期待大家可以思考一下這些看法。
質(zhì)量問題,是所有人的責(zé)任,而不僅僅是一個(gè)測(cè)試員的責(zé)任或者成千上萬測(cè)試員的責(zé)任。如果你想讓你的家庭幸福美滿,那么你不能將家庭中的某一個(gè)人指定為幸福的擔(dān)保人,而同時(shí)一旦出現(xiàn)任何問題,便把責(zé)任完全推給這個(gè)人。如果一個(gè)家庭想永遠(yuǎn)都幸福美滿,那么必須全家人都要參與來共同營(yíng)造這個(gè)美好幸福的家。
同理,如果要保證產(chǎn)品的質(zhì)量,那么客戶、需求、設(shè)計(jì)、開發(fā)、測(cè)試以及售后支持都必須承擔(dān)平等的責(zé)任。
然而,有一些根本不重視測(cè)試或者假裝自己很重視測(cè)試的公司,表面上是為每一個(gè)項(xiàng)目都安排一個(gè)測(cè)試員,而一旦客戶發(fā)現(xiàn)了問題,把責(zé)任全部推到測(cè)試員身上。這些自認(rèn)為是質(zhì)量守護(hù)神的測(cè)試員,會(huì)覺得因?yàn)槁y(cè)了一個(gè)缺陷而開始內(nèi)疚,認(rèn)為自己該為這個(gè)問題負(fù)責(zé)任。
這些情況發(fā)生的原因是,大多數(shù)測(cè)試員還沒用弄清楚測(cè)試到底是什么。他們認(rèn)為測(cè)試是提高質(zhì)量,但實(shí)際上不是提高質(zhì)量,而是尋找與質(zhì)量有關(guān)的信息。
報(bào)告缺陷:如果沒有人關(guān)注修復(fù)缺陷,那么產(chǎn)品質(zhì)量本身是不會(huì)有提高的。如果你做過測(cè)試,那么你肯定有這么一個(gè)感觸,修復(fù)一個(gè)缺陷,可能導(dǎo)致更多的缺陷出現(xiàn)。所以,測(cè)試員報(bào)告一個(gè)缺陷,當(dāng)這個(gè)缺陷被修復(fù)之后,很可能又有新問題產(chǎn)生,此時(shí)的軟件質(zhì)量反而降低了。
同時(shí),我也承認(rèn)這一點(diǎn):缺陷少并不意味著質(zhì)量高。Jerry Weinberg, 軟件測(cè)試界的奇才,在20世紀(jì)60年代的時(shí)候,開展測(cè)試團(tuán)隊(duì)的工作的第一人。他認(rèn)為“質(zhì)量只是對(duì)于那些與其有關(guān)的人才有價(jià)值”,而后,Michael Bolton把這句話拓展為“測(cè)試員的職責(zé)是要找出與其有關(guān)的是什么人和什么事”。實(shí)在太了不起了!
如果測(cè)試員還繼續(xù)認(rèn)為自己是質(zhì)量守護(hù)神的話,那么將會(huì)出現(xiàn)以下的問題:
與開發(fā)人員的爭(zhēng)論:測(cè)試員視開發(fā)人員為惡魔,因?yàn)槭撬麄兞畹杰浖|(zhì)量低劣,并與之展開爭(zhēng)論,然后開發(fā)人員也開始不尊重測(cè)試團(tuán)隊(duì),這會(huì)影響到整個(gè)團(tuán)隊(duì)的表現(xiàn)。因此,導(dǎo)致這種情況出現(xiàn)的測(cè)試員們,不僅僅是損壞他們的名聲,而且也損壞了我們的名聲。
這像擊球手指責(zé)投手令其要跑一大圈一樣。如果一個(gè)板球隊(duì)伍想要運(yùn)作的好的話,那么擊球手和投手必須緊密合作,從而獲取比賽的勝利。有時(shí)候是擊球手表現(xiàn)不好,而有時(shí)候是投手表現(xiàn)不好。你應(yīng)該知道,自己和開發(fā)人員是一樣的,都是普通人,你們都會(huì)犯錯(cuò)誤。然而,致力于思考的話則可以幫助團(tuán)隊(duì)獲得成功。
遺漏缺陷時(shí)的內(nèi)疚:當(dāng)出現(xiàn)漏測(cè)一個(gè)缺陷時(shí),測(cè)試員認(rèn)為是由于自身的緣故而造成的。這樣的測(cè)試員沒有想到自己僅僅是團(tuán)隊(duì)中的一員,這是整個(gè)團(tuán)隊(duì)的責(zé)任。我的意思是,對(duì)于漏測(cè)缺陷這個(gè)責(zé)任,整個(gè)團(tuán)隊(duì)都需要負(fù)責(zé)任。
相關(guān)推薦

最新發(fā)布
性能測(cè)試之測(cè)試環(huán)境搭建的方法
2020/7/21 15:39:32軟件測(cè)試是從什么時(shí)候開始被企業(yè)所重視的呢?
2020/7/17 9:09:11Android自動(dòng)化測(cè)試框架有哪些?有什么用途?
2020/7/17 9:03:50什么樣的項(xiàng)目適合做自動(dòng)化?自動(dòng)化測(cè)試人員應(yīng)具備怎樣的能力?
2020/7/17 8:57:06幾大市面主流性能測(cè)試工具測(cè)評(píng)
2020/7/17 8:52:11RPA機(jī)器人能夠快速響應(yīng)企業(yè)需求,是怎么做到的?
2020/7/17 8:48:05Bug可以真正消滅嗎?為什么?
2020/7/17 8:43:03軟件測(cè)試基本概念是怎么來的?軟件測(cè)試生命周期的形成歷經(jīng)了什么?
2020/7/16 9:11:10